1. Motion and Forces | 运动与力

The average speed of an object is the total distance travelled divided by the time taken. For motion with constant acceleration, the SUVAT equations link initial velocity, final velocity, acceleration, displacement and time.

物体的平均速度是行驶的总距离除以所用时间。对于匀加速直线运动,SUVAT 方程将初速度、末速度、加速度、位移和时间联系起来。

average speed = distance / time    v = s / t

a = (v – u) / t

v² = u² + 2 a s

s = u t + ½ a t²

Newton’s Second Law states that the acceleration of an object is directly proportional to the resultant force acting on it and inversely proportional to its mass. Weight is the force due to gravity acting on a mass.

牛顿第二定律指出,物体的加速度与作用在其上的合力成正比,与其质量成反比。重力是作用在质量上的引力。

F = m a

W = m g

On Earth, g ≈ 9.8 m/s² and is often taken as 10 m/s² in estimation questions. The stopping distance of a vehicle is the sum of the thinking distance and the braking distance.

地球上的 g 约等于 9.8 m/s²,估算题中常取 10 m/s²。车辆的停车距离是反应距离和制动距离之和。


2. Energy and Work | 能量与功

Work is done when a force moves an object through a distance. Energy cannot be created or destroyed, only transferred, stored or dissipated. Kinetic energy depends on mass and speed, while gravitational potential energy depends on mass, height and gravitational field strength.

当力使物体移动一段距离时,就做了功。能量既不能被创造也不能被消灭,只能被转移、储存或耗散。动能取决于质量和速度,而重力势能取决于质量、高度和引力场强。

W = F d

Eₖ = ½ m v²

Eₚ = m g h

Eₑ = ½ k e²

Power is the rate of energy transfer or the rate of doing work. Efficiency compares useful output energy or power with total input.

功率是能量转移或做功的速率。效率将有用的输出能量或功率与总输入进行比较。

P = E / t = W / t

efficiency = (useful output energy / total input energy) × 100%

In closed systems, total energy is conserved. Energy changes often appear as Sankey diagrams, where the width of the arrows represents the amount of energy.

在封闭系统中,总能量守恒。能量变化常以桑基图表示,其中箭头的宽度代表能量的大小。


3. Electricity | 电学

Electric charge, current, potential difference and resistance are linked by a set of fundamental equations. Ohm’s Law applies to components where the resistance remains constant as current changes.

电荷、电流、电压和电阻由一组基本方程联系在一起。对于电阻随电流保持不变的元件,欧姆定律成立。

Q = I t

V = I R

Power in an electrical circuit can be calculated using current and voltage, or current and resistance. Resistors in series add directly, while in parallel the reciprocal of the total resistance equals the sum of the reciprocals.

电路中的电功率可用电流和电压或电流和电阻计算。串联电阻直接相加,并联时总电阻的倒数等于各电阻倒数之和。

P = I V

P = I² R

R_total = R₁ + R₂ + …

1/R_total = 1/R₁ + 1/R₂ + …

The energy transferred by a component also depends on the charge and voltage across it. This leads to the equation E = Q V, which can be combined with Q = I t to give E = I V t.

元件转移的能量还取决于通过它的电荷量及两端电压。由此可得 E = Q V,再结合 Q = I t 可得到 E = I V t。

E = Q V


4. Waves | 波

All waves obey the wave equation, which relates wave speed, frequency and wavelength. For electromagnetic waves, the speed in a vacuum is the same for all types and is approximately 3.0 × 10⁸ m/s.

所有波都遵循波动方程,该方程将波速、频率和波长联系起来。对于电磁波,真空中所有类型的波速相同,约为 3.0 × 10⁸ m/s。

v = f λ

When a wave crosses a boundary between two media, it changes speed and direction unless it strikes along the normal. Snell’s law uses the refractive index n, and the critical angle c is the angle of incidence for which the angle of refraction is 90°.

当波穿过两种介质的边界时,除非沿法线入射,否则波速和方向会改变。斯涅尔定律使用折射率 n,临界角 c 是折射角为 90° 时的入射角。

n = sin i / sin r

sin c = 1 / n

The period of a wave is the time for one complete oscillation and is the reciprocal of the frequency. T = 1/f is commonly used in both mechanical and electromagnetic contexts.

波的周期是一次全振动的时间,是频率的倒数。T = 1/f 在机械波和电磁波中普遍使用。

T = 1 / f


5. Particle Model of Matter | 物质粒子模型

Density measures how much mass is packed into a given volume. The internal energy of a system is the total kinetic and potential energy of its particles. Heating a substance increases its temperature or changes its state.

密度衡量给定体积内含有多少质量。系统的内能是其粒子的总动能和势能之和。加热物质会使其温度升高或改变其状态。

ρ = m / V

The energy required to raise the temperature of a given mass depends on the specific heat capacity c. During a change of state, the temperature remains constant and the energy needed is given by the specific latent heat L.

升高给定质量物质的温度所需的能量取决于比热容 c。物态变化期间温度保持不变,所需的能量由比潜热 L 表示。

ΔE = m c Δθ

E = m L

For a fixed mass of gas at constant temperature, the product of pressure and volume is constant. This is often tested by describing the behaviour of particles inside a sealed container.

对于一定质量的气体,在恒温下压力和体积的乘积为常数。常通过描述密封容器内粒子的行为来考查此式。

p V = constant


6. Atomic Structure and Radioactivity | 原子结构与放射性

Atoms consist of a nucleus containing protons and neutrons, surrounded by electrons. Radioactive decay is a random process in which an unstable nucleus emits alpha, beta or gamma radiation. The activity of a source is the number of decays per second.

原子由含有质子和中子的原子核以及绕核运动的电子组成。放射性衰变是一个随机过程,不稳定的原子核会放出 α、β 或 γ 射线。源的活度是每秒衰变的次数。

A = ΔN / Δt

The half-life of an isotope is the time taken for half the radioactive nuclei in a sample to decay, or for the count rate to halve. The number of remaining nuclei after n half-lives can be calculated.

同位素的半衰期是样本中一半放射性原子核发生衰变,或计数率减半所需的时间。经过 n 个半衰期后剩余的原子核数目可用公式计算。

N = N₀ (1/2)ⁿ

Nuclear equations must balance the total atomic (proton) number and the total mass (nucleon) number. Alpha decay reduces the mass number by 4 and atomic number by 2; beta decay increases the atomic number by 1 with no change in mass number.

核反应方程必须使总原子序数(质子数)和总质量数(核子数)守恒。α 衰变质量数减 4、原子序数减 2;β 衰变原子序数加 1,质量数不变。


7. Forces and Pressure | 力与压强

Pressure is the force acting perpendicularly per unit area. It is a scalar quantity and has units of pascals (Pa), where 1 Pa = 1 N/m².

压强是垂直作用在单位面积上的力。它是一个标量,单位为帕斯卡 (Pa),1 Pa = 1 N/m²。

p = F / A

Pressure in a liquid increases with depth and density, and acts equally in all directions at a given depth. The equation p = h ρ g can be used for a static column of liquid. In a hydraulic system, pressure is transmitted equally, allowing a small force applied to a small area to produce a large force on a larger area.

液体的压强随深度和密度增加而增大,并在同一深度向各个方向同等作用。公式 p = h ρ g 适用于静止液柱。在液压系统中,压强被等大地传递,使施加在小面积上的小力能在大面积上产生大力。

p = h ρ g


8. Magnetism and Electromagnetism | 磁与电磁

A current-carrying wire produces a magnetic field. When a conductor cuts through magnetic field lines, a potential difference is induced. Transformers change the voltage of an alternating current and rely on the principle of electromagnetic induction.

载流导线产生磁场。当导体切割磁力线时,会感应出电动势。变压器改变交流电的电压,依赖于电磁感应原理。

For an ideal transformer where all the magnetic flux links both coils, the ratio of the voltages equals the ratio of the number of turns in the coils. The input power equals the output power in a 100% efficient transformer.

对于理想变压器(所有磁通量均交链两个线圈),电压之比等于线圈匝数之比。在 100% 效率的变压器中,输入功率等于输出功率。

Vₚ / Vₛ = Nₚ / Nₛ

Vₚ Iₚ = Vₛ Iₛ

The motor effect describes the force experienced by a current-carrying wire in a magnetic field. The size of the force can be increased by using a stronger magnet, a larger current, or a longer length of wire within the field.

电动机效应描述了载流导线在磁场中受到的力。力的大小可通过使用更强的磁体、更大的电流或更长的导线在磁场中来增大。


9. Space Physics | 空间物理

Planets and satellites orbit in nearly circular paths. The orbital speed can be calculated using the circumference of the orbit and the orbital period. For an object in a stable orbit, the speed changes only if the radius changes.

行星和卫星以近似圆形的轨道运行。轨道速度可通过轨道周长和轨道周期计算。对于在稳定轨道上的物体,只有当半径改变时速度才会改变。

v = 2πr / T

Redshift provides evidence for the expanding universe. When a galaxy moves away from us, the wavelength of its light is stretched. The redshift z is the fractional change in wavelength and relates to the recessional velocity v and the speed of light c.

红移为宇宙膨胀提供了证据。当星系远离我们时,其光的波长被拉长。红移 z 是波长的分数变化,与退行速度 v 和光速 c 有关。

z = Δλ / λ₀ = v / c

Hubble’s law states that the recessional velocity of a galaxy is directly proportional to its distance from us. The constant of proportionality is the Hubble constant H₀.

哈勃定律指出,星系的退行速度与其距离成正比。比例常数是哈勃常数 H₀。

v = H₀ d


10. Key Constants and Unit Conversions | 重要常数与单位换算

Many calculations require using standard values or converting between units. This quick reference list will help you avoid common mistakes.

许多计算需要使用标准值或进行单位换算。这份快速参考清单将帮助你避免常见错误。

Constant / 常数 Value / 数值
Acceleration of free fall, g 9.8 m/s² (use 10 m/s² for estimation)
Speed of light in vacuum, c 3.0 × 10⁸ m/s
Charge on an electron, e 1.6 × 10⁻¹⁹ C
Planck constant, h 6.63 × 10⁻³⁴ J s
1 kilowatt-hour (kWh) 3.6 × 10⁶ J

Common unit prefixes include milli (m, 10⁻³), centi (c, 10⁻²), kilo (k, 10³), mega (M, 10⁶) and giga (G, 10⁹). When substituting into formulas, remember to convert all quantities to SI base units: metres, kilograms, seconds, amperes, etc.

常见的单位前缀包括毫(m, 10⁻³)、厘(c, 10⁻²)、千(k, 10³)、兆(M, 10⁶)和吉(G, 10⁹)。代入公式时,记得将所有量转换为国际单位制基本单位:米、千克、秒、安培等。
